Output 826147407afc18a186f7c6dc7d7e255928286577bcde0d768fb1f9f26f6f5762:0

value
95400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0d7850b7c37a3bf63afe448c2087af4c83359e8 OP_EQUALVERIFY OP_CHECKSIG
address
1L3FjUQLzknxo6qBizpq4BE2nEeVUMz9yc
transaction
826147407afc18a186f7c6dc7d7e255928286577bcde0d768fb1f9f26f6f5762
spent
true